Francois Gouget <fgouget(a)codeweavers.com> writes:
* If one runs 'configure --enable-win64' on a 32 bit platform, one would want to make sure to use x86_64-${host_os}-pkg-config rather than plain pkg-config. That can be accomplished by adding another AC_CHECK_PROGS in the relevant 'case $host' branch but it led me to think that maybe a more general mechanism would be better.
I don't think there's any 32-bit platform where --enable-win64 would work, and we don't support it anyway. -- Alexandre Julliard julliard(a)winehq.org
